Umariya Alis Kachniya Tola in context

With 341 people at the 2011 Census, Umariya Alis Kachniya Tola was the 462nd most populous of its district's 653 villages, below the district average of 818.

Literacy stood at 57.62%, 5.3 points below the district's rural average of 62.94%.

The sex ratio was 884 women per 1,000 men (72 below the district's rural figure of 956). Among children aged 0–6 the ratio was 756, 167 below the rural national 923.
